Man Shoots Younger Brother Dead Over Dog Meat

Last updated: January 25, 2020 5:52 am
Track News
Share
SHARE

TRACKING___A 35-year-old Ghanaian man identified as Kwaku Kandarira, has been arrested for killing his younger brother over a dog meat argument.
The victim, 30-year-old, Attah Azimma was shot dead at Papaase, near Assam, in the Ashanti Region.

According to a report by, Adomonline, Attah was shot by Kwaku Kandarira, after confusion ensued between them over the head of cooked dog meat.
Kandarira was the one who prepared the meat but Attah wanted to use his own means to get the sweetest part which is the head.

The suspect quickly dashed off to his room, pulled out a gun and fired his own brother in the head over the bowl of contention that existed between them.
Azimma’s body has since been deposited in a morgue for autopsy whilst police have also apprehended Kandarira to assist in investigations. The residents of Papaase disclosed that the two brothers lived together peacefully until the shooting incident on Thursday
After detaining the suspect, the police also took his gun as an exhibit.
